How to set DAX TX Gain programmatically?
I'd like to modify the DAX TX gain from a program but cannot discover how to do it by watching with Wireshark.
When I manipulate the DAX RX gain slider in SmartSDR DAX 3.7.3 it is easy to see commands going to the radio, e.g. C37097|audio stream 0x4000009 slice 0 gain 28 when I adjust the slice A gain slider.
But no command at all is shown when I adjust the TX gain slider. ???? (If I click off the blue TX button I see C37124|stream remove 0x84000001, and if I click it on again I see C37126|stream create type=dax_tx)
I have also tried using the TXGain and Gain properties of a FlexLib DAXTXAudioStream object, but although I can get and set them, they have no effect.

I may be wrong but I believe the slider changes the attenuation in Windows under sound devices, not in the radio.

Interesting idea (controlling TX level via Windows sound device volue), but this is apparently not the case. I tried bringing up System → Sound → All Sound Devices → Properties for DAX Audio TX. Manipulating the volume there has absolutely no effect on the level between e.g. WSJT-x and the Flex, nor does manipulating the SmartSDR DAX TX Gain Slider make any changes to the Windows DAX Audio TX device slider
